Day 11 / Delhi - Agra
Early morning drive to the city of Taj- Agra , Arrive
Agra in approx. 4 hours &
transfer to hotel. Afternoon visit the Red fort - the rusty
and majestic red- sandstone fort of Agra stands on the banks
of the river Yamuna and the construction was started by
Emperor Akbar in 1566. At the Diwan-I-Am (hall of public
audience),a colonnaded hall of red-sandstone with a throne
alcoveof inlaid marble at the back,the Emperor heard public
petitions. At the Diwan-I-Khas (hall of private audience)
where marble pavilions with floral inlays lend an ethereal
ambience, the Emperor sat on his gem-studded peacock Throne
and met foreign ambassadors and rulers of friendly kingdoms.
Later at sunset visit the magnificient Taj Mahal - one of
the seven wonders of the world surely the most extravagant
expression of love ever created. 20,000 men laboured for
over 17 years to build this memorial to Shah Jahan's beloved
wife.Evening free to explore the Agra’s rich heritage of
handicrafts in its markets. Night stay in Agra.
Day 12 / Agra - Jaipur
After breakfast drive to Jaipur- the fabled “pink
city”of the desert named after Jai Singh, the former
Maharaja of Jaipur. This is the only city in the world
symbolizing the nine divisions of the universe through the
nine rectangular sectors subdividing it. The palaces and
forts of the yesteryears, which were witnesses to the royal
processions and splendours are now living monuments enroute
visiting Fatehpur Sikri-a perfectly preserved red sandstone
“ghost town”which was the estranged capital of mughal
emperor Akbar, built in 1569 and deserted when its water
supply failed. Arrive Jaipur in late evening & transfer to
hotel. Night stay in Jaipur.
Day 13 / Jaipur
After a leisurely breakfast
, visit the majestic Amber Fort, is one that cannot be
easily described. Ride up on Elephants to the former capital
of the royals set against the backdrop of the wooded hills.
Later visit the Palace of Winds also known as Hawa mahal,
this elaborate building, now little more than a façade, is
encrusted with delicate screen sand carved balconies from
which the royal ladies, confined to their quarters, could
sneak views of the outside world. Past, present and future
merge at Jai Singh's observatory, where time has been
accurately measured since the 17th century. Evening enjoy
dinner at Chokhi dani (an ethnic village resort) where you
will have an idea of the village life of Rajasthan here you
will also enjoy various traditional Rajasthani dances,puppet
show and various other interesting activities. Night stay in
Jaipur.
